Official release notes, quoted from ldraw.org: """ LDraw.org Library Update 2008-01 September 10, 2008 This release is complete re-issue of the official library, up to and including the last (2005-01) parts update, with the primary purpose of aligning the library with the Contributor Agreement. This clarifies the redistribution status of the part files within the library, and standardises the file headers. To this end, a total of 90 files have been excluded from the re-distributable library because we have been unable to contact the original author or persuade them to affirm the Contributor Agreement. The current community of LDraw part authors is working to re-create those parts so that they can be added to the re-distributable library in a subsequent parts update. In addition to separating the parts that are not re-distributable, We have taken the opportunity to separate two additional classes of part files and make their installation optional in a new Windows installation package. - Alias parts : generic colour versions of parts that are physically identical to parts in the core parts library, but have a different part number, either because of production differences between opaque and transparent parts or due to evolution of the part numbering scheme. - Physical colour parts : hard-coded colour versions of parts or composite parts. No new parts are included in this update, but its release does now make it possible to restart the more regular publication of additions to the library. Minor changes have been made to part descriptions as part of the header standardisation. """
